Tapa Cloth2947/5

Large brown tapa cloth decorated with geometric designs in black and light brown. The linear designs create four chevron-like patterns bisected by a column of circles. These circles alternate between pairs of black and medium brown dots. The cloth is organized into five rows of two long rectangles. All four sides are bordered by a black line. Two sides have an addition border of alternating black and medium brown triangles against a light brown base. The vertical line at the cloth’s centre is framed on both sides by the same triangular pattern.

Culture
Samoan
Material
paper mulberry bark and pigment
Made in
Samoa
Holding Institution
MOA: University of British Columbia

Head Ring2922/2

Circular braided cedar bark head ring with an abalone shell crest in the shape of an eagle attached to the front below the bark ties. Eaglet skin, with the fine, soft down still attached, covers the entire top area and hangs down in a tail at the back, below the head ring. The head ring is lined with cotton.

Culture
Kwakwaka'wakw
Material
cedar bark, eagle skin, abalone shell and cotton fibre
Made in
British Columbia, Canada
Holding Institution
MOA: University of British Columbia

Basket2936/3

Round, woven cedar basket, straight sided. The basket is made of cedar slats wrapped with cedar root, with two intertwining rows of wrapped looping along the rim. The exterior is decorated with diagonal lines of triangles in light brown, red and dark brown.

Culture
Coast Salish: Squamish
Material
cedar wood, cedar root, cherry bark and canary grass
Made in
Squamish, British Columbia, Canada ?
Holding Institution
MOA: University of British Columbia

Basket2936/5

Rectangular woven cedar basket with attached lid. Basket is made with cedar root wrapped around an under-structure of cedar slats. The exterior is decorated with red, light brown and dark brown imbrication in a large zigzag pattern. The lid is attached to the basket with two hide thongs on one of the longer sides. It is decorated with a pattern of imbricated squares in the same colour as that on the body. There are two hide ties attached to the front of the basket and the edge of the lid to tie it closed.

Culture
Coast Salish: Squamish
Material
cedar wood, cedar root, cherry bark, rawhide skin and canary grass
Made in
Squamish, British Columbia, Canada ?
Holding Institution
MOA: University of British Columbia

Basket2936/2 a-b

Rectangular woven cedar basket, with flat slightly oval lid (part b) that fits tightly inside the rim. The basket is made of cedar slats wrapped with cedar root, cherry bark (red and black) and grass imbrication designs on all sides and lid. The lid has eight separate 'butterfly' designs; the long sides have a large central design surrounded by four small crosses, while each end repeats the main design. The central design is a widened star-like design with four side points, with wider, squared-off top and bottom points. The lid has a short lip; the base of the basket is almost flat.

Culture
Coast Salish: Squamish
Material
cedar wood, cedar root, cherry bark, grass and dye
Made in
Squamish, British Columbia, Canada ?
Holding Institution
MOA: University of British Columbia
